div怎么添加一个点击事件onClick?

图片描述
我的意思就是上图红红的框是个div,id="div"
我怎么写事件使得点击弹出 “成功”?

<div id="div">点击</div>
阅读 118.9k
9 个回答

上面几个朋友说的都对

第一种方法,直接在div上添加onclick

<div id="div" onclick="alert('成功')">点击</div>

第二种,DOM0级事件处理

var oDiv = document.getElementById("div");
oDiv.onclick = function(){
    alert("成功");
}

第三种,DOM2级事件处理

var oDiv = document.getElementById("div");
oDiv.addEventListener("click", function(){
    alert("成功");
});

<div id="div" onclick="alert('成功')">点击</div>
你自己不都已经说了onclick了吗

$("#div").on("click",function(){
    alert("成功");
});

在标签上直接加也可以<div id="div" onclick="alert('成功')">点击</div>
在js标签里加也可以

 <script type="text/javascript">
    var divM = document.getElementById("div");
    divM.onclick = function () {
           alert("成功");
       }
 </script>
新手上路,请多包涵
$("#div").on("click",function(){
    alert("成功");
})

$(document).on("click","#div",function(){

alert("成功");

})

???
提问的意义在哪里

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题